The Aero Alchemy: A Masterclass in Downforce Generation
The most immediately striking and functionally profound enhancements of the Manthey Kit lie within its comprehensive aerodynamic overhaul. On the track, aerodynamics are the invisible hand that dictates speed, stability, and grip. Manthey, with its unparalleled expertise honed on the Nürburgring Nordschleife, has sculpted a suite of components designed to manipulate airflow with surgical precision, extracting every ounce of performance without significant drag penalties.
Let’s dissect these additions, piece by piece, to understand the meticulous engineering at play:
Redesigned Front Lip: Extending nearly half an inch further than stock, this seemingly minor alteration has a monumental impact. By presenting a larger surface area to the oncoming air, it increases the pressure differential over the front axle. This subtle but effective change generates more downforce at the front, enhancing steering precision, turn-in response, and front-end grip during high-speed cornering. For an expert driver, this translates directly to greater confidence entering a bend, allowing for later braking and earlier throttle application. It’s about more than just brute force; it’s about subtle control of the turbulent air that defines a car’s interaction with the road.

Wider Rear Wing with Gurney Flap: The GT3’s rear wing is already a work of art, but Manthey’s iteration takes it to another level. The increased width provides a larger surface for air to act upon, while the addition of a Gurney flap – a small, perpendicular lip on the trailing edge – dramatically increases the wing’s efficiency. This flap creates a localized area of high pressure on the top surface and a lower pressure area beneath, effectively “pulling” the rear of the car into the track. This translates to substantial rear axle downforce, critical for stability under acceleration and high-speed cornering, especially through rapid changes in direction. Think of it as a finely tuned rudder, ensuring the car remains planted and predictable even at the absolute limit.
Extended Rear Diffuser Fins: Beneath the car, the diffuser is an aerodynamic marvel, designed to accelerate airflow from under the vehicle, creating a low-pressure zone that sucks the car to the ground. Manthey’s kit features longer fins, meticulously shaped to optimize this Venturi effect. The extended length allows for a more gradual expansion of the airflow, reducing turbulence and maximizing the pressure differential. The result is increased underbody downforce, a cleaner wake, and reduced overall drag. This is where subtle engineering triumphs, quietly generating immense grip where it matters most.
Carbon Fiber Aerodiscs for Rear Wheels: These striking carbon fiber discs aren’t merely aesthetic flourishes; they are functionally critical components. Wheel wells are notoriously turbulent areas, creating significant aerodynamic drag. By covering the spokes of the rear wheels, these aerodiscs smooth out airflow, reducing drag and contributing to overall aerodynamic efficiency. Moreover, their design can also assist in managing airflow around the brakes, potentially aiding in cooling or directing air away from other critical components. This sophisticated integration of form and function highlights the kit’s holistic approach to performance.

Extended Underbody Turning Vanes: Perhaps the most “invisible” yet impactful addition is the extension of the underbody turning vanes. These vanes, nearly 59 inches longer than the stock 39-inch units, are pivotal in guiding and optimizing the airflow along the car’s underside. They work in conjunction with the front lip and rear diffuser to create a fully optimized flat underbody, preventing turbulent air from disrupting the meticulously managed flow beneath the vehicle. To accommodate these extended vanes and ensure a completely smooth underbody profile, a specialized cover is fitted over the luggage compartment floor. This attention to detail underscores Manthey’s commitment to maximizing ground effect, contributing significantly to mechanical grip at speed.
The culmination of these aero enhancements is staggering. In its most relaxed, road-friendly setting, the Manthey GT3 generates a remarkable 782 pounds of downforce. However, when configured for track attack, this figure rockets to an astonishing 1,190 pounds. What’s truly remarkable, and a testament to the combined engineering prowess of Manthey and Porsche, is that this massive increase in downforce has been achieved without any corresponding increase in aerodynamic drag. This is the holy grail of automotive aerodynamic enhancements: more grip, more stability, without the penalty of reduced straight-line speed. For any driver pushing the limits on high-speed circuits, this level of downforce translates directly into higher cornering speeds, greater braking stability, and an almost magnetic connection to the tarmac.
Precision Tuned: The Manthey-Developed Suspension System
Downforce is nothing without a suspension system capable of harnessing it. Recognizing this synergy, Manthey and Porsche have co-developed a bespoke four-way adjustable coilover suspension setup that is not just optimized but essential for extracting the kit’s full potential on track.
The term “four-way adjustable” is crucial here. It signifies independent control over rebound (how quickly the shock absorber extends) and compression (how quickly it compresses) at both high and low speeds. This level of granular control allows for meticulous tuning, adapting the car’s behavior to specific track characteristics, tire compounds, ambient temperatures, and even individual driving styles.
Independent Rebound and Compression Adjustment: Rebound damping influences the tire’s ability to maintain contact with the road after encountering a bump, while compression damping dictates how quickly the suspension compresses under load (e.g., braking, cornering). High-speed settings deal with sudden, sharp impacts (curbs, large bumps), while low-speed settings control chassis movements during cornering, braking, and acceleration. This precise adjustability allows an experienced technician or driver to fine-tune weight transfer characteristics, optimize tire contact patch, and mitigate unwanted chassis movements. The ability to make these adjustments without tools further enhances convenience during intense track days, allowing for quick, on-the-fly setup changes to adapt to evolving track conditions.
Increased Front Axle Spring Rates: A significant detail for the 992.2 GT3 Manthey Kit is the 10 percent increase in front axle spring rates compared to the 992.1 GT3’s Manthey offering. This modification isn’t arbitrary; it’s a direct response to the substantially increased downforce generated by the 992.2 kit’s aerodynamics. Higher spring rates at the front are necessary to prevent excessive compression under the immense aerodynamic load, ensuring the car maintains its optimal ride height and aerodynamic platform. This, in turn, preserves the efficiency of the front lip and underbody vanes, prevents the car from bottoming out, and enhances the precision of turn-in, providing a more direct and confidence-inspiring steering feel. It’s a calculated adjustment that ensures the suspension system can effectively manage and utilize the aero benefits.
The overall impact of this suspension system is profound. It provides the GT3 with an even greater degree of mechanical grip, sharper handling characteristics, and a more predictable, communicative chassis. For a driver who lives for the limit, this translates into higher entry and exit speeds, minimized body roll, and a heightened sense of connection to the road – ultimately leading to faster lap times and a more engaging driving experience. This is what truly separates a track-capable car from a track-optimized machine; every input is met with an immediate, precise response.
The Genesis of Greatness: Porsche & Manthey’s Unbreakable Bond
The credibility and desirability of the Manthey Kit are underpinned by the extraordinary partnership between Porsche and Manthey Racing. Manthey is not merely an aftermarket tuner; it is Porsche’s official partner for its FIA World Endurance Championship (WEC) racing operations and a dominant force in Nürburgring endurance racing. This symbiotic relationship ensures that every component in the Manthey Kit is subjected to the same rigorous development, testing, and quality control standards as a factory Porsche component.
This collaboration brings several critical advantages to the discerning buyer in 2025:
Motorsport-Derived Technology: The kit is a direct transfer of competition knowledge and technology from the most demanding racetracks in the world to a road-legal package. It’s born from the crucible of endurance racing, where reliability and ultimate performance are paramount.
Factory Warranty Retention: This is arguably one of the kit’s most compelling selling points. Unlike most aftermarket modifications that void a factory warranty, the Manthey Kit is sold as an accessory package via Porsche, allowing installation by authorized dealers without invalidating the car’s original warranty. This provides an unparalleled level of confidence and peace of mind for an investment of this magnitude.
Uncompromising Quality and Fitment: Given Manthey’s integral role in Porsche’s racing programs, the fit, finish, and material quality of every component are exceptional, perfectly integrating with the GT3’s existing architecture. This isn’t a bolt-on solution; it’s an engineering extension.

Conquering the Green Hell: The Nürburgring Statement
The ultimate validation for any performance upgrade lies in its measurable impact on the track. For the Porsche 911 GT3, there is no more definitive proving ground than the Nürburgring Nordschleife – the “Green Hell.” When equipped with the new Manthey Kit and unleashed on this legendary 12.94-mile circuit, the 992.2 GT3 set an astonishing lap time of 6:52.981 minutes.
To put this into perspective: this time is a full 2.76 seconds faster than the already incredibly quick 992.1 GT3 equipped with its own Manthey Kit. In the relentless pursuit of ultimate lap times, shaving off even a tenth of a second on the Nordschleife is an enormous achievement. To improve by nearly three full seconds is nothing short of revolutionary.

The “Manthey” branding itself carries significant weight. Beyond the performance, the kit includes subtle yet sophisticated aesthetic touches: illuminated carbon fiber door sill trims proudly displaying the Manthey logo, distinctive door lettering, and high-visibility tow straps for both front and rear bumpers. These details serve as badges of honor, signaling to fellow enthusiasts that this isn’t just a GT3; it’s a meticulously optimized machine, part of an elite tier of performance.
